HARTLAND, Wis. (CBS 58) -- Students at Divine Redeemer Lutheran School in Hartland were greeted with some "playoff pancakes" Tuesday morning ahead of the Brewers NLCS Game 2.

The treats were a nod to Brewers Head Coach Pat Murphy and his pocket pancakes, which have become a symbol of the Brewers' incredible season. 

In total, the school handed out more than 500 pancakes to students.
